Hi Sam,
IMO more important that the "radios.ini" file when it comes to connectivity
is the "Dxbase2004.ini"
in the Windows directory. You may have missed
something in the Tools/Options/UserOptions/Radio1
settings. Here is the [Radio] section in mine:
[Radio]
BAUD=4800
STOPBITS=2
PORT=1
CONNECT=1
FILTER=0
RTTY=0
PARITY=NONE
WORD=8
DEFAULT=1
RADIO=Yaesu_FT1000MP
HFDTR=1
FILEPATH=C:\Amateur Radio\Pegasus\
FILETYPE=0
HFRTS=1
Make sure this section of the file is exactly the same as the
"Dxbase2003.ini". If not paste in the "Dxbase2003.ini" [Radio] part into
the [Radio]
part of the "Dxbase2004.ini". Don't want to copy
and paste? At least compare the two and look for any differences.

Here is the problem:
I recently upgraded from Dxbase 2003 to the 2004
version (via a CD shipped to
me). I have been using v.2003 with my Icom 756Pro
for over 18 months with no
problems. I run Win XP Pro. As soon as I
installed and used v.2004, I found
that I COULD NOT log the frequency from the
transceiver. I get a hash number
(316416.56) for the freq., and "75G" in the "Band"
column every time,
regardless of the actual settings. I COULD QSY
and change mode from within the 2004
program, and with other control software that I
own.
I checked the program settings for the IC 756 Pro
and they are correct ?
identical to those used in my v. 2003. I then ran
Dxbase 2003, which I retained
on my hard drive, and found that it WORKED
PERFECTLY (as before) and logged
freq. and band correctly.
Upon Jim's suggestion, I chnaged the name of the
radios.ini in v.2004 and
pasted in the radios.ini from v2003, which works
perfectly. No change!
Given the above, I know that a) my transceiver
works and communicates
properly; and b) that nothing is wrong with my
computer and interface cable.
Any one else out there with a 756Pro having (or
not having) this prob?
Help, PLS.
